Conolidine is derived through the plant Tabernaemontana divaricata, normally called crepe jasmine. This plant, native to Southeast Asia, is usually a member in the Apocynaceae relatives, renowned for its assorted assortment of alkaloids.
Conolidine’s capability to bind to unique receptors within the central nervous procedure is central to its pain-relieving properties. As opposed to opioids, which primarily concentrate on mu-opioid receptors, conolidine reveals affinity for various receptor styles, presenting a definite system of action.

Conolidine was initial synthesized in 2011 as part of a research by Tarselli et al. (60) The initial de novo pathway to synthetic manufacturing discovered that their synthesized kind served as efficient analgesics in opposition to Continual, persistent pain in an in-vivo design (sixty). A biphasic pain product was used, wherein formalin Answer is injected right into a rodent’s paw. This ends in a Main pain response straight away following injection along with a secondary pain reaction 20 - forty minutes after injection (sixty two).
